2007 BMW 525 vs. 1969 Cadillac DeVille
To start off, 2007 BMW 525 is newer by 38 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1969 Cadillac DeVille.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1969 Cadillac DeVille would be higher. At 6,954 cc (8 cylinders), 1969 Cadillac DeVille is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1969 Cadillac DeVille (288 HP @ 4600 RPM) has 98 more horse power than 2007 BMW 525. (190 HP @ 3500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1969 Cadillac DeVille should accelerate faster than 2007 BMW 525.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1969 Cadillac DeVille weights approximately 425 kg more than 2007 BMW 525.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
